Output 95cd6ac30973be45201a760ff2b547c866a6aaa31bc186fd957c70f3119b1bb5:0

value
8558629
script pubkey
OP_0 OP_PUSHBYTES_20 310b4ea3cf243768c709aa35cb26e8832bcc1aaa
address
bc1qxy95ag70ysmk33cf4g6ukfhgsv4ucx42258zav
transaction
95cd6ac30973be45201a760ff2b547c866a6aaa31bc186fd957c70f3119b1bb5
spent
true